Overview

A used spectrum analyzer is a pre-owned electronic instrument that measures the magnitude of an input signal versus frequency within the full frequency range of the instrument. These devices are essential for RF engineers, telecommunications professionals, and electronics manufacturers who need to analyze signal characteristics. Purchasing a used spectrum analyzer can be a cost-effective solution for businesses that require high-end equipment but have budget constraints. These instruments are commonly available from equipment resellers, laboratory liquidations, or upgrades from other companies.

Structure and Working Principle

A spectrum analyzer consists of several key components: an input attenuator, a mixer, an IF (intermediate frequency) amplifier, a detector, and a display. The device works by converting the input signal into an intermediate frequency, which is then processed and displayed as a frequency spectrum. Modern used spectrum analyzers may include digital signal processing (DSP) capabilities, allowing for more precise measurements and advanced analysis features. The working principle remains similar across different models, though specific implementations may vary between manufacturers and generations of equipment.

Key Features

Used spectrum analyzers typically offer frequency ranges from 9 kHz up to several GHz, with higher-end models reaching into the millimeter wave spectrum. Key specifications include resolution bandwidth, dynamic range, phase noise, and sweep speed. Many used models maintain important features such as peak hold, average detection, and marker functions. Some advanced units may include vector signal analysis capabilities or tracking generator functions for more comprehensive testing scenarios.

Application Areas

Used spectrum analyzers find applications across various industries. In telecommunications, they're used for base station testing and signal monitoring. Broadcast engineers use them for transmitter alignment and interference hunting. Electronics manufacturers employ spectrum analyzers for EMC testing and product development. Research laboratories utilize them for scientific measurements and experimental setups where cost-effective equipment is preferred.

Maintenance and Precautions

When purchasing a used spectrum analyzer, it's crucial to verify its calibration status and operational condition. Regular maintenance should include periodic calibration, cleaning of connectors, and proper storage in controlled environments. Users should be cautious about input signal levels to avoid damaging sensitive front-end components. Proper grounding and use of appropriate attenuators are essential for accurate measurements and equipment longevity.

B2B Procurement Guide

When sourcing used spectrum analyzers, buyers should consider several factors. The required frequency range and resolution bandwidth should match the intended applications. The instrument's condition and service history are critical for assessing remaining lifespan. Buyers should verify the availability of technical documentation and software compatibility. It's advisable to purchase from reputable dealers who offer warranty periods and calibration services. For reference, prices typically range from $1,000 for basic models to $20,000 for high-performance units.
